Senate confirms anti-DEI stalwart Andrea Lucas to second term at top workplace civil rights agency

Source: apnews.com apnews.com
Key Topics in this News Article:
Antisemitism Biden Civil Rights Columbia Congress Donald Trump education Judaism Law LGBTQ New York Racism Religion Senate University
News Snapshot:
NEW YORK (AP) — The Senate confirmed Andrea Lucas to another term as commissioner of the country’s workplace civil rights agency, demonstrating firm Republican support for her efforts to root out diversity programs, roll back protections for transgender workers and prioritize religious rights in the workplace. Democratic lawmakers and prominent civil rights groups fiercely opposed Lucas’ confirmation, saying she has subjected the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ission to the whims of the president, who elevated her to acting chair in January and, in an unprecedented act, fired two of the agency’s Democratic commissioners before their terms expired.
